Translation Recordings closes the 2012 release year by adding another new artist to the roster. This time it's Washington, DC producer Nature Rage, who demonstrates his multi-genre talents with a soulful pair of tracks in the spirit of the Universal Grooves LP. 'Games' is the ethereal and blissful union of half-tempo grooves and deep bass music with lush pads, and an infectious arppegiated sequence that modulates outward across the soundscape. The dreamlike vibes continue on 'Let Me Show You,' where Nature Rage dials the tempo back, allowing the track's warm analogue bassline flow back and forth like massive surges of electric current across 140 BPM percussion. Rhodes keys and synth chords intertwine and dance over layers of dissipating atmospherics. With such diversity and emotion behind his music, it's no surprise that his tracks have been supported by the likes of multi-genre chameleons DFRNT and Om Unit.
